William Shakespeare only lived from 1564 to 1616, but his works have lived on the stage and on the page for four centuries. Several authors in this anthology examine the biographical evidence and the continuing controversy over Shakespeare’s authorship of the works attributed to him; others focus on why Shakespeare’s works have proven relevant and inspiring to so many generations of readers, writers, scholars, and artists. The words Shakespeare coined, the characters he created, his plays and poems are his legacy, which permeates our language and culture today. Readers will learn about William Shakespeare’s talent, skills, intellect, and charisma, and how he made an impact on his time, for better or worse.
